While most lodges are unable to offer a classic safari experience, our pristine and diverse wilderness, and partnership with the Maasai community, enable us to provide you with a unique and unforgettable classic safari.
Your safari with us will mean having 280,0000 acres of Maasai wilderness with thousands of animals all for yourself, exploring it with a Maasai tracker, being able to walk with him and learning how to read footprints and identify scats; it will also mean hiking into the cloud forest of the Chyulu Hills; it will mean seeing many different species of wildlife, birds, trees, while in complete privacy, not surrounded by other tourists.
Luca will brief you about Campi ya Kanzi and Maasai Wilderness Conservation Trust on your arrival.
He will learn from you what your interests are, what your previous African experiences have been, what you like most.
With your help, he will tailor-make the perfect safari for you.
You will be able to choose from these diverse options:

  • Game drives in open Land Rover, with your professional guide and Maasai tracker
  • Walk, escorted by your guide and by your tracker, in the cloud forest, exploring a unique habitat
  • Walk, escorted by your guide and by your tracker, in the savanna or to look-out hills
  • Tailored safaris for keen photographers
  • Tailored safaris for keen birds watchers
  • Dine in the bush, for either breakfast, lunch or dinner
  • Cave dining! Dine in a huge cavern, where the Maasai where hiding the cattle they were raiding from the Wakamba, a tribe living on the other side of the Chyulu Hills  
  • Join "Among Lions" a special one week safari run with the Trust, studying the lion population of the reservation
  • Botanical safaris with a Maasai tracker, who will explain you the different use the Maasai makes of plants
  • Visit your Maasai tracker's home, in his village, to learn about Maasai culture
  • Visit the Trust programs in conservation, health, and education 
  • At Campi ya Kanzi visit Kanzi Academy, a gifted pupils primary school, attended by 8 Maasai pupils
  • Sundowners (aperitives at sunset) with a Maasai elder, who will -next to a fire - share with you his Maasai lore, explaining their history and traditions. 
  • Excursion to Tsavo National Park, where Mzima spring is home to tens of hippo and crocodiles
  • Kilimanjaro scenic flight, inclusive of a bush champagne breakfast
  • Air excursions to Tsavo or Chyulu Hills
  • Air excursion to Amboseli National Park, where one of our car will be waiting for you for a game drive
  • Fly camping, along side a river or in the plains in front of Mt. Kilimanjaro
